West Coast TVET College Is Looking for 50 Youth to Join Their 2026 Computer Technician Learnership (NQF Level 5) – Closing Date: 08 August 2025

Are you young, unemployed, and passionate about computers and technology? Then this opportunity could change your life. West Coast TVET College, in partnership with the Wholesale and Retail Sector Education and Training Authority (W&RSETA), is now accepting applications for the 2026 Computer Technician Learnership Programme at their Atlantis Campus.

This NQF Level 5 learnership is specifically designed for unemployed South African youth who want to start a career in IT. If selected, you’ll gain hands-on experience, formal training, and receive a R3,500 monthly stipend to help you during the programme.

What’s in the Programme?

Here’s a quick look at what this learnership offers:

  • 📘 Qualification: Occupational Certificate – Computer Technician (NQF Level 5)
  • 🕒 Duration: Year 1 of training (2026)
  • 🏫 Location: Atlantis Campus, West Coast TVET College
  • 💼 Positions Available: 50 learnerships
  • 💸 Stipend: R3,500 per month (to support you during the programme)
  • 🎓 Funded By: W&RSETA

What You’ll Learn

By the end of this programme, you’ll have solid technical skills including:

  • Assembling and maintaining PC hardware
  • Installing and updating software
  • Troubleshooting technical problems
  • Providing IT support to customers or businesses
  • Working in retail, help desk, or IT support environments

This qualification is nationally recognised, meaning you’ll be able to apply for real jobs in the IT or retail industry—or even start your own small tech support business.


Who Should Apply?

This opportunity is open to:

  • Unemployed South African youth under 35 years old
  • Those with at least a Grade 12 certificate or equivalent
  • People who live in or near Atlantis, Western Cape
  • Young people who are serious about building a future in tech

Preference may be given to previously disadvantaged individuals, but all interested candidates are welcome to apply.

How to Apply

Follow these steps to apply for the learnership:

  1. Prepare your documents:
    • Certified copy of your South African ID
    • Certified copies of your academic qualifications
    • Proof of residence
    • A short motivational letter explaining why you want to join the programme
  2. Upload your documents online through the West Coast TVET College portal:
    👉 Visit: www.westcoastcollege.co.za
  3. Look for the Computer Technician NQF Level 5 Learnership advert, and follow the instructions to apply.

📞 For enquiries, contact Angela Donn at 021 577 1729
